Common Symptoms to Watch For

Symptoms range from mild confusion to severe unresponsiveness. Other signs include fever, seizures, and focal neurological issues like hemiparesis. These symptoms can vary widely, so awareness is key.

Physical Examination Clues

Physical examination may reveal clues like parotitis, suggesting mumps, or flaccid paralysis indicating West Nile virus. Tremors and specific rashes can also guide diagnosis. Each symptom offers important diagnostic hints.

Viral encephalitis is an inflammation of the brain caused by a viral infection, with symptoms ranging from mild confusion to severe neurological impairments like seizures and hemiparesis.
